Virtual Machines: Revolutionizing the Way We Work and Play Online

Virtual machines are software-based emulations of physical computers that allow users to run multiple operating systems on a single physical machine. Each virtual machine runs its own operating system and applications independently of the host system, making it a cost-effective and efficient way to utilize hardware resources.

Virtual machines are commonly used for testing software applications, running legacy applications, and isolating environments for security purposes. They can also be used for running multiple virtual servers on a single physical server, reducing the need for additional hardware.

Virtual machines are managed through virtualization software, such as VMware, VirtualBox, or Hyper-V, which allocate resources from the host machine to the virtual machines. Users can create, configure, and manage virtual machines through a user-friendly interface, allowing for easy deployment and maintenance of virtualized environments.
